Three hotels we've stayed at and liked in the Latin Quarter, and are in your budget, are: Hotel St. Jacques - we've stayed here twice, had room with a balcony which we really enjoyed but all rooms are nice Hotel des Grandes Ecoles - nice garden Hotel du Pantheon - in your budget depending on when

We stayed at the Hotel Home Latin in the fall of 2011 and would happily do it again. It is on a quiet side street convenient to Notre Dame, Luxembourg Gardens, the Panthoen etc.

I second Alexander's recommendation of the Familia Hotel. The Familia is not on Rick's list, but neither are a lot of good hotels. It is north of the Sorbonne, in a quiet, more traditional part of the Latin Quarter, away from the tacky strip of tourist traps and heavy traffic along the other side of the quarter.
